Comprehending the factors that affect the cost of glazing services can assist customers in budget planning. Here's a list of components that generally affect prices:
Type of Glass: Specialty glass, such as tempered, laminated, or low-E glass, tends to cost more due to its production process.Size and Area: Larger installations need more material and labor, thus increasing the general cost.Intricacy of Installation: Intricate styles or difficult structural features may demand additional labor and time.Place: Urban locations with a greater demand for services may incur additional transit costs and overheads.Labor Costs: The expertise and experience level of the glazier will influence hourly rates.How to Find an Affordable Glazier

Q3: What types of glass are best for energy efficiency?A3: Low-emissivity(low-E) glass is known for its energy-efficient properties as it reflects heat while allowing light in, making it an ideal choice for climate control.
